Jo Malone London Beach Blossom has a drift-from-the-bow nuance – the scent you might get approaching a lush and vegetal island with the sun high and the aroma of native plants catching the breeze. It’s a soft scent – the opening is kick of Mojito with lime and mint that’s quickly followed by solar warmth and a sensual languidity. In the background is coconut water that you’ll pick out from time to time – if you go looking, it won’t necessarily appear but now and again, you get a waft of it. There’s also the smallest hint of sun tan lotion but it’s hard to pinpoint the notes – maybe it’s more of a nuance – and the entire arrangement is given a creaminess by tonka. If you like a big fragrance, this isn’t the one for you but if you prefer subtilty and a quiet confidence (and have your linens ironed and ready), it’s very much for you.
